NHS Ayrshire & Arran successfully bid to host Foxgrove: the National Secure Adolescent Inpatient Service for young people aged between 12 and their 18th birthday who present a level of risk. We are now moving towards the finalisation of the build and the clinical model with the expectation that the service will be accepting the first young people in the Summer of 2022.

NHS Ayrshire & Arran is investing in the provision of safe, effective, person-centred care for the most vulnerable and high risk children across Scotland and has been chosen to provide a National Secure Child and Adolescent Inpatient Unit on behalf of all Scottish health boards. The campus is situated in the south west of Scotland on the Firth of Clyde coastline. Ayrshire and Arran is a 30 minute drive from Glasgow - Scotland’s largest city - and an easy commute by road or rail to our capital city Edinburgh. The area boasts sports and recreational facilities, including golf courses, water sports, award winning visitor attractions and a rich culture and heritage, in addition to a vast array of restaurants and bars. The area is supported by an excellent network of road and rail services, with easy access to Glasgow International Airport. There is excellent affordable housing and good schools locally.
